Deposit Withdrawals Reached 5.5 billion Euros in September

Greek banks witnessed a downwards trend after the total withdrawal of 5.5 billion euros in September.
According to the data released by the Bank of Greece on Tuesday, Greek households and enterprises’ deposits withdrawals reached 183.2 billion from 188.6 billion euros in late September under the burden of the new emergency taxes and income decreases.
Political and economical instability are the main reasons why Greeks have chosen to withdraw money from their deposit accounts decreasing their rate by 14% compared to last year.
The trend continues downwards.
